To configure SBC call testing:
1.
Configure the test call parameters (for a full description, see ''SIP Test Call
Parameters'' on page 787):
a.
Open the Test Call Settings page (Configuration tab > System menu > Test
Call > Test Call Settings).
b.
In the 'Test Call ID' field, enter a prefix number for the simulated test endpoint on
the device.
c.
In the 'SBC Test ID' field, enter a called prefix number for identifying the call as
an SBC test call.
d.
Click Submit.
2.
Configure regular SBC call processing rules for called number prefix "101", such as
classification and IP-to-IP routing through a proxy server.
